

The aim of the ROSCAR
Celebratory Awards is to applaud Filmmakers for
their hard work and to maximise audience participation and enjoyment.
The public are thus encouraged to watch these international and
local films and VOTE
on the film entries.
At each cinema screening, cinema goers will receive
a pamphlet. The pamphlet contains information detailing criteria
to look out for when watching a screening, and will assist when
casting a vote.

* Film entries
into the children’s category – The best children’s wildlife
production - are being screened at selected schools in South
Africa, and not at Nu Metro cinemas. This is to maximise on
the number of young viewers. After each screening the
children will judge which film they liked best.
